Precious is a new movie set to be released on November 6, 2009. Tyler Perry and Oprah Winfrey have joined forces to present this independent movie. The movie, directed by Lee Daniels, is based on the book “Push” by Sapphire and centers around a young teenage mother, Clareece “Precious” Jones. Precious is a victim of abuse and struggles with issues of self esteem and self hate. Despite these challenges, Precious is a story of triumph and perseverance in the face trial and tribulation.
In an email to his fans, Tyler Perry discusses the movie and why he wanted to get involved with its production. Here is an excerpt:
“This movie was so real and so incredibly relevant that I had to get involved. I called Oprah and she said she had the film but hadn’t had time to see it yet. A couple of hours later she called me back after she had seen it. Neither of us could speak. We both sat in silence on the phone for a while. Hearing all that was said without words. What was amazing was that after that initial moment of “WOW!” we both ended up with the same feelings of overwhelming joy. So we decided to join together to present this film. I think the world should see it. Not only is it groundbreaking and real but it caused me to remember and to thank God I made it through that. I’ll tell you more as it gets closer but just know that the reason I signed on to executive produce this movie is because I know I’m not alone. I know that there are millions of people out there who went through what I went through, what Oprah went through, and what Precious went through. And we all can say, “Thank God we made it!!”
